Description
Summary:After Leonard moves back into the home he grew up in to mend a broken heart, he meets two women in quick succession. Michelle is a mysterious and beautiful neighbor. Sandra is the lovely and caring daughter of a businessman who is buying out his family's dry-cleaning business. Leonard is forced to make an impossible decision, between desire and the comfort of love, or risk falling back into the same darkness that nearly killed him.
Item Description:DVD release of the 2008 motion picture.
Special features: commentary with director James Gray; behind the scenes; deleted scenes; HDNet: a look at Two Lovers; photo gallery.
